Bread

184 kcal per 100 g, with 7.8 g protein, 31.8 g carbs and 1.9 g fat. Full micronutrients and serving info below.

Why does Bread have a Nutri-Score of A?

Nutri-Score weighs negatives (calories, sugar, saturated fat, sodium) against positives (fiber, protein) per 100 g. Points against come from sodium (448 mg); points in favor come from fiber (4.3 g). Overall that places it in band A.
